    All of the following are antipsychotics, EXCEPT:

    A.

    Quetiapine

    B.

    Risperidone

    C.

    Ziprasidone

    D.

    Bromocriptine

    Correct option is D

    Bromocriptine is not an antipsychotic; it is a dopamine agonist used primarily to treat conditions like Parkinson's disease and hyperprolactinemia. The other options, quetiapine, risperidone, and ziprasidone, are all antipsychotics used to treat psychiatric disorders like schizophrenia and bipolar disorder.
    Explanation of options: (a) ✔ Correct. Quetiapine is an atypical antipsychotic. (b) ✔ Correct. Risperidone is an atypical antipsychotic. (c) ✔ Correct. Ziprasidone is an atypical antipsychotic. (d) ✘ Incorrect. Bromocriptine is not an antipsychotic; it is a dopamine agonist used for other medical conditions.
